Article Detail

小程序研发标准化落地方法论

本文提出一套覆盖全生命周期的小程序研发标准化落地方法论,包含标准化四步法、组件化/自动化/可观测性实践及组织保障机制,助力企业提升研发效能与交付质量。

返回文章列表

导语

在小程序生态快速扩张的今天,研发效率、交付质量与团队协同正面临严峻挑战。重复造轮子、规范缺失、跨端兼容性差、测试覆盖率低等问题,已成为制约中大型企业规模化落地小程序的关键瓶颈。本文提出一套可复用、可度量、可演进的小程序研发标准化落地方法论,覆盖设计、开发、构建、测试、发布与运维全生命周期,助力技术团队实现从“项目制交付”向“平台化运营”的转型升级。

一、为什么需要标准化?——从痛点出发的底层动因

当前小程序研发普遍存在三大典型问题:一是缺乏统一组件库与设计语言,UI 一致性差,设计师与前端反复对齐;二是工程配置碎片化,各业务线使用不同构建工具链(如 Taro、UniApp、原生小程序框架),导致基建维护成本高;三是发布流程依赖人工操作,灰度策略缺失,线上事故响应滞后。标准化不是束缚创新,而是为高速迭代提供稳定底盘。

二、标准化落地四步法:定义 → 沉淀 → 接入 → 治理

  1. 定义标准:联合产品、设计、前端、测试、运维制定《小程序研发规范白皮书》,明确命名约定、目录结构、API 设计原则、错误码体系、日志埋点规范等;
  2. 沉淀资产:建设企业级小程序基础平台,包含统一 CLI 工具、可插拔组件库(支持微信/支付宝/百度多端)、自动化代码检查规则(ESLint + 自定义规则集);
  3. 接入降噪:通过脚手架一键生成符合标准的项目模板,集成 CI/CD 流水线(含单元测试、E2E 测试、视觉回归检测、安全扫描);
  4. 持续治理:建立“标准健康度看板”,监控组件复用率、规范检查通过率、构建失败率等核心指标,并通过月度技术评审机制推动迭代优化。

三、关键实践:组件化、自动化与可观测性三位一体

  • 组件化:推行“原子组件 → 模块组件 → 场景组件”三级复用体系,所有业务组件须基于 Design Token 和统一 Hooks 封装,确保样式与逻辑解耦;
  • 自动化:将代码规范检查、接口契约校验(基于 OpenAPI)、多端兼容性测试(使用 miniprogram-simulate)嵌入 PR 流程,拦截率提升至 92%;
  • 可观测性:统一接入前端监控平台(性能、异常、资源加载),结合小程序专属会话追踪能力,实现从用户点击到服务端调用的全链路定位。

四、组织保障:设立“小程序标准委员会”

打破职能壁垒,由架构师牵头,联合各业务线技术负责人组成虚拟委员会,每双周同步标准执行情况、受理提案、评审新组件入库、更新规范版本。配套建立内部认证机制——通过《小程序标准化工程师》能力考核的成员,方可主导新项目立项与架构评审。

小结

小程序研发标准化不是一纸文档,而是一套“规范+平台+机制+文化”的组合拳。它不追求一步到位,而是以最小可行标准(MVS)启动,在真实业务交付中持续验证、反馈与进化。当每个团队都能复用同一套高质量资产、遵循同一套可靠流程,小程序才真正从“应用载体”升级为“数字生产力引擎”。